The Backbone of Engineering A Deep Dive into the Bolts, Nuts, and Washers Factory
In the realm of engineering and manufacturing, the importance of robust fastening systems cannot be overstated. A Bolts, Nuts, and Washers factory plays a crucial role in the production of these essential components, serving as the backbone for countless applications across various industries. Understanding the intricacies involved in the manufacturing of these fasteners sheds light on their crucial role in modern engineering.
At the heart of the factory is advanced technology dedicated to producing a wide range of bolts, nuts, and washers, each designed for specific functions and capacities. The raw materials, primarily steel, aluminum, and various alloys, are carefully selected for their strength, durability, and resistance to corrosion. The selection process is fundamental, as the quality of the final product hinges on the quality of the materials used.

Nuts, often produced to match the bolts, are created through similar machining practices. The factory employs CNC (Computer Numerical Control) machines, which allow for precision and consistency in the manufacturing process. This precision is vital, as even the slightest deviation can lead to incompatibility with bolts or result in structural failures in applications where these components are utilized.
Washers, though small in size, play an equally important role in fastener systems. They are designed to distribute the load of a bolt or screw over a larger surface area, thus preventing damage to the material being fastened. The production of washers involves stamping processes that ensure they meet the specific requirements of thickness and diameter needed for different applications.
Quality control is paramount in a Bolts, Nuts, and Washers factory. Each batch of products is subjected to rigorous testing to ensure they meet industry standards and specifications. This includes tensile strength tests, corrosion resistance evaluations, and dimensional checks. Such measures not only safeguard the integrity of the products but also instill confidence in customers who rely on these fasteners for critical applications.
In addition to quality, sustainability has become a guiding principle for modern fastener manufacturing. Factories are increasingly adopting eco-friendly practices, from sourcing recycled materials to implementing energy-efficient processes, thereby reducing their carbon footprint and environmental impact.
